Innova® 3100 OBD2 Code Reader. Find out why the “Check Engine” light illuminated on 1996 & newer cars, light trucks and minivans with this hand-held code reader. Just plug it into the vehicle’s universal connector (usually found under the dashboard), push a button and get the same information your mechanic takes hours to pull in about 10 seconds. If any trouble codes appear, access the included manual to define the problem. It’s great to use before going to the mechanic, getting an emissions test, taking a road trip, buying a used car or attempting repairs on your own. Innova® 3320 Auto-Ranging Digital Multimeter. This handy, feature-packed tool is ideal for quick and easy automotive and household electrical testing. Its auto-ranging function eliminates the guesswork of dialing in electronic measurement ranges. Its 10 MegOhm circuitry is safe for use on vehicles. And its color-coded lights let you quickly check a battery’s state of charge. It also features patented ergonomic design with wrist strap for hands-free testing; attachable test leads, holders and stand; and rubber corner guards for drop protection. Suggested uses include: household outlets, fuses, writing, automotive circuits, fuses, vehicle battery and charging systems, and much more.
